Common Admission Requirements For Barber SchoolsIn Wauconda, Illinois

Before applying to barber schools in Wauconda, it's important to understand the typical admission requirements:

  • Age: Most programs require applicants to be at least 16 years old. Some schools may require you to be 18 or have parental approval if underage.

  • Educational Background: A high school diploma or equivalent (GED) is usually necessary to gain admission. Some programs may request transcripts or proof of completion.

  • Application Process: Interested students should fill out an application form, often available online, and may need to provide personal essays or letters of recommendation.

  • Skills Assessment: Some programs may require a skills assessment or personal interview to gauge interest and aptitude for barbering.

  • Certifications: Students should check if there are any preliminary certifications or program-specific requirements needed before admission.

Meeting these prerequisites ensures that prospective students are adequately prepared to embark on their barber education. Each school may have slight variations in their requirements, so it is vital to review each institution’s guidelines thoroughly.

Cost & Financial Aid Options For Barber Schools In Wauconda, Illinois

Financing barber school is an essential consideration for many students. Here's what you can generally expect in terms of costs and available financial aid:

  • Tuition Costs: The average tuition for barber programs in Wauconda can range from $10,000 to $20,000 depending on the school and course duration. Programs typically last between 9 to 18 months.

  • Additional Expenses: Students should also consider materials, tools (e.g., clippers, shears), and textbooks, which can add an additional $300 to $1,200 to their total costs.

  • Financial Aid: Many barber schools offer financial aid options, including grants, scholarships, and student loans. Prospective students are encouraged to fill out the F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id) to determine their eligibility for federal financial aid programs.

  • Work-Study Programs: Some institutions may offer work-study arrangements, allowing students to work within the school while earning credits toward their tuition.

Potential students should contact their desired barber schools directly to inquire about scholarship opportunities, payment plans, and other financial support services that can assist in managing educational costs.

Barber Salary in Illinois
Annual Median: $35,310
Hourly Median: $16.98
Data sourced from Career One Stop, provided by the B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ics wage estimates.
PercentileAnnual Salary
10th$31,040
25th$31,950
Median$35,310
75th$35,880
90th$65,210
